The journey from Mhaswad to Satara covers approximately 75 km through the heart of the Satara district. MSRTC buses are the primary mode of transport, connecting the rural interior to the district headquarters. The route typically takes 2 hours depending on traffic near the Satara city entry points. You will travel via the Mhaswad-Dahiwadi-Satara road, which offers scenic views of the plateau landscape. It is a vital route for locals commuting for administrative and medical purposes.

Total Distance: Driving distance is 75 km; straight-line distance is 62 km.

Things to Do in Satara
1
Ajinkyatara Fort
A historic fort overlooking Satara city. It offers panoramic views of the surrounding Sahyadri ranges.
2
Thoseghar Waterfalls
Located near Satara, these are among the highest waterfalls in Maharashtra. Best visited during the monsoon season.
3
Kaas Plateau
A UNESCO World Heritage site known for its seasonal wildflowers. It is a must-visit for nature enthusiasts.
4
Shivaji Museum
Houses artifacts related to the Maratha Empire. It provides deep insights into local history.
